Inducible Expression Vectors
10
Protein produced in a large quantity in bacteria can be toxic, so it is advantageous to keep a cloned gene repressed before expressing it.
Solution: keep the cloned gene turned off by placing it downstream of an inducible promoter
that can be turned off .IPTG strongly induce lac promoter

Phage λ
13
A phage λ virion has a head, which contains the viral DNA genome, and a tail, which functions in infecting E.coli host cells.
Advantages over plasmids: They infects cells much more efficiently than plasmids transform cells. The yield of clones with vectors usually higher.
Because of its efficiency, phage λ is often used in library construction.

H4-3 BaculovirusInfects insect cellsThe strong promoter expressing polyhedrin protein can be used to over-express foreign genes engineered. Thus, large quantities of proteins can be produced in
infected insect cells .Insect expression system is an important eukaryotic expression system.

Strategy for generating recombinant adenoviralvectors. The therapeutic gene is inserted into a cytomegalovirus(CMV) expression cassette multiple-cloning site (MCS) in theadenovirus (Ad) shuttle plasmid (pAdCMVLink), which containsthe left-hand portion of the adenovirus genome minus theE1 gene (0–1 mu and 9–16 mu). The plasmid is transfectedwith the adenovirus genome minus 59 inverted terminal repeat(ITR) region into 293 cells, where the recombinant virus canpropagate.
